Crab Orchard National Wildlife Refuge
Crab Orchard National Wildlife Refuge, located in Carterville, Illinois, United States, is a beautiful park that offers visitors the opportunity to reconnect with nature and enjoy a variety of outdoor activities. From hiking and canoeing to hunting and birdwatching, there is something for everyone to enjoy at this national wildlife refuge. The refuge is home to a diverse range of wildlife, including bald eagles, wild turkeys, white-tailed deer, and a variety of songbirds. Visitors can easily pay entrance fees, buy annual vessel passes, or reserve campsites online before their visit. The refuge will also be a great viewing area for the total solar eclipse in April 2024, with over 4 minutes of total eclipse viewing time. Special use permits are required for some commercial, recreational, and research activities at the refuge.

South Marcum Recreational Area
South Marcum Recreational Area, located at 12220 Rend City Road in Benton, Illinois, is a campground, lodging, and park situated along the picturesque Rend Lake. Covering over 20,000 acres of water and land, this area is a haven for wildlife such as deer, turkey, fox, and waterfowl. The campground at South Marcum offers over 100 reservable campsites with electric hookups for RVs. Amenities include a dump station, hot showers, flush toilets, and drinking water. A playground is conveniently located within the Whispering Pines camping loop for guests to enjoy.

McKinley Woods
McKinley Woods, located at 26932 River Bluff Drive in Channahon, Illinois, is a 531-acre park and tourist attraction that offers a variety of outdoor activities and educational opportunities. The preserve features two access areas, Frederick's Grove and Kerry Sheridan Grove, both located in Channahon. McKinley Woods is part of the Des Plaines River preservation system, conserving over 2,400 acres of diverse habitats including forest, prairie, wetland, and a portion of the Des Plaines River. Visitors can enjoy hiking, running, cross-country skiing, snowshoeing, and fishing at the preserve.
